October 22, 201411 yr The shooter, Michael Zehaf-Bibeau, began his shooting at 9:52am at the Ottowa War Memorial where he shot a 24 year old reservist on the honor guard at the memorial, Corporal Nathan Cirillo. Cirillo later died of his injuries. Zehaf-Bibeau then continued up the street to the main Parliament building, where he entered at 9:54am and exchanged fire with guards inside the building. Zehaf-Bibeau has been confirmed dead, and although there are no official reports of how he died, Parliament member Craig Scott has Tweeted that Kevin Vickers, Sergeant at Arms of the House of Commons, was responsible for shooting the gunman. There were also initial reports of a shooting at the nearby Rideau Centre mall, but those reports have since been confirmed false.

Also, the same Twitter account that first posted the picture of the alleged shooter was also being followed by Martin Couture-Rouleau. Couture-Rouleau was a 25 year old Quebec native who converted to Islam about a year ago. He had reportedly been embracing Islamic extremist attitudes, and had been very vocal about his anger with Canada for their support of US airstrikes against ISIS. This past Monday, October 20th, Couture-Rouleau intentionally ran over two Canadian soldiers, killing one, and leaving the other still hospitalized with life-threatening injuries. After crashing his car in the police chase that followed his hit-and-run, Couture-Rouleau jumped out of his car and came at the police with a knife, and was shot dead in the process.
